Monument Valley straddles the Arizona–Utah border on Navajo land, its great sandstone buttes rising from the desert floor. An old Navajo dwelling sits at the foot of one towering butte, dwarfed by the red-rock landmark behind it.
Stephen Milner photographed the scene in black and white as a storm broke over the valley, lightning and dark cloud above the dwelling and butte.
